Alastair Campbell Talks Politics: An unmissable, new, illustrated non-fiction book about politics and government for young people. Summary:

THE empowering intro to politics that EVERY young person needs right now from writer, podcaster and strategist ALASTAIR CAMPBELL.
**Longlisted for the SLA Information Book Award 2025**
Politics made fun? YES, REALLY!
Writer, podcaster and strategist, Alastair Campbell, makes politics exciting, relatable and personal – AT LAST!
Alastair shares his incredible knowledge and passion to empower young people and give them the skills and confidence they need to understand how the country is run, how they can get involved, encourage them to have a view, or take a stand, give them tips about how to debate, and so much more!
EVERYONE should have a copy of this brilliant guide to understanding the world of politics, which is bursting with Q&As, quizzes, tips, challenges, plus quotes and interviews from a range of people, including KEIR STARMER, RORY STEWART, KEIRA KNIGHTLEY and LINDSAY HOYLE.
